Tummy Tuck

Tummy tuck is a surgical procedure in which the removel of excess fat and excess skin is performed to get a flatter and more aesthetic abdomen appearance. Also known as “abdominoplasty” or “excess skin removal surgery”, tummy tuck is suitable for those who experience deformities in their tummy area due to major weight loss, pregnancy, or ageing.

TUMMY TUCK SURGERY

Tummy tuck surgery makes loosened abdominal muscles tightened and stronger; stronger muscles provide better support to the core of the body and help to reduce the back pain and improve posture. After a tummy tuck, patients achieve a more confident posture and do not feel back pain caused by inadequate support from the abdominal muscles.

Excess skin removal surgery starts with incisions made according to the chosen technique to remove the excess skin and fat around the tummy area. During a tummy tuck, underlying muscles will be tightened which also very beneficial for those who have given birth and have loose muscles. When all the necessary changes are done, the tummy area is closed by sutures. 

During a tummy tuck operation, ventral hernia can also be repaired. Moreover, tummy tuck reduces the risk of hernia occurring again by strengthening the muscles.

How Long Does a Tummy Tuck Take?

The duration of tummy tuck may change between 2-5 hours depending on the technique.

According to your medical history, the physical condition of your tummy and your expectations from the operation, you will be provided with the most suitable technique and treatment plan in your consultation process.

Types of Tummy Tuck Surgery

Depending on the amount and size of the skin and fat which needs to be removed for the best results, excess skin removal surgery can have different types such as;

  • extended tummy tuck, 
  • regular tummy tuck 
  • mini tummy tuck
  • lipoabdominoplasty

The difference between types of this operation is the size of the incisions made. While in extended tummy tuck the length of the incision may extend until your back throughout your bikini line to obtain better results for your condition; in mini tummy tuck the incision is usually relatively shorter than regular and extended tummy tuck.

Recovery After Tummy Tuck

It is normal to experience pain and swelling after tummy tuck. You will be prescribed with antibiotics and painkillers to minimize the side effects. It takes around 2 to 4 weeks to get back to your daily routine and to your job after tummy tuck depending on the level of the physical activity, your job and lifestyle require. Tummy tuck incision scars should be taken care of as instructed by your surgeon; they will fade away on a large scale until 6th month. To prevent any opening of incisions, you should avoid positions which may strain your belly area for around 1-2 months after tummy tuck.
